About the Role
Alpha Financial Markets Consulting (Alpha FMC) is the leading global consultancy to the asset and wealth management industry. As a boutique management consulting firm, we provide top-tier asset and wealth managers a competitive edge through our unparalleled expertise and industry insights. Founded in 2003 with headquarters in London, we expanded rapidly and successfully went public (IPO in October 2017).
Our client base includes all of the world’s top 20 and 80% of the top 50 asset managers by AUM, with over 870 clients globally. Headquartered in the UK, Alpha operates 17 international offices, including the US, Canada, Luxembourg, France, Netherlands, Switzerland, Denmark, Germany, Singapore, and Australia, employing over 990 full-time consultants.
Our Regulatory Compliance & Risk practice supports clients in meeting regulators’ evolving expectations and ensuring alignment with industry standards. With deep regulatory, risk, and market practice knowledge, we work directly with clients’ exec teams to drive impactful, hands-on change.
The Senior Consultant will lead high-stakes client engagements and play a critical role in shaping regulatory and risk strategy for leading asset and wealth managers. This is a rare opportunity to shape the future of compliance and risk execution within the industry.
